Role
We are currently looking for a Butler to join our team of associates at Rosewood London. Our Butlers are appointed to assist our suites guests with enthusiasm, efficiency and professionally at all times. This role offers a schedule of 40 hours spread over 5 working days. This role plays an integral part in pursuing Rosewood London’s aim of being the hotel of choice for suite guests.
Key expectations of this role are
- Effectively prioritising tasks in an engaging, refined and intuitive manner.
- Handling complex guest requests and complaints according to Rosewood London standards.
- Being proactive in managing in advance the arriving and departing guests’ suites, ensuring Special Attention Guests receive a memorable experience.
- Possessing a thorough knowledge of the company philosophy, core values, responsibilities, daily activities of the day and all about the hotel facilities.
- Overseeing our guest needs during their stay helping them with reservations, special requests, rooms, hotel orientation, bag packing and unpacking, laundry, shoe shine etc.
Profile
- Paying exceptional attention to detail by not comprising on quality standards.
- The ability to work in a team and build relationships with the others.
- Being organised and proactive in managing your tasks.
- Having a passion for guest service and taking ownership of the guest experience.
